Azerbaijan, Georgia launch e-Permit for freight transport

Azerbaijan and Georgia have begun implementing the electronic permit (e-Permit) system for international freight transport by road, Olaylar informs, citing the Azerbaijan Land Transport Agency (AYNA) under the Ministry of Digital Development and Transport.

According to the agreement, a joint working group composed of representatives from both countries started technical integration work on May 1, and the process was successfully completed.

To enable active use of the system, the two sides initially exchanged 1,000 bilateral permits, 1,000 transit permits, and 1,000 third-country electronic permit forms, which have already begun to be distributed to carriers.

Previously, the e-Permit system had been successfully applied with Türkiye, Uzbekistan, Kyrgyzstan, and Kazakhstan.

Carriers can obtain electronic permit forms via the e-xidmet.ayna.gov.az portal without leaving their location, operating in a fully automated mode 24/7.
